1.5. SAFETY CLASSIFICATION AND REGULATIONS
SAFETY CLASSIFICATION
•
Protection against electric shock:
Determined by the electric
shock protection type of the computer connected to the USB
•
Classification of applied part:
Type BF applied part (cushion)
•
Method(s) of sterilization:
No requirement for sterilization
•
Protection against harmful ingress of water or particulate matter:
IP20
•
Mode of operation:
Continuous
•
Suitable for use in an oxygen rich environment:
No
STANDARDS
The Insight Video Goggles complies with the following standards:
• IEC 60601-1: Medical Electrical Equipment. Part 1: General requirements for safety
• IEC 60601-1-2: Medical Electrical Equipment. Part 2: Electrical Safety
• IEC 62471-1: Photobiological safety of lamps and lamp systems
• ISO 10993-1: Biological Evaluation of Medical Devices - Part 1: Evaluation
and Testing Within a Risk Management Process. (Biocompatibility)
• ISO 10993-10: Biological evaluation of medical devices -
part 10: tests for irritation and skin sensitization
• ISO 10993-5: Biological evaluation of medical devices
- part 5: tests for in vitro cytotoxicity
External equipment intended for connection to USB complies with the applicable
standards of the IEC 60601 series. In addition, all such combinations of systems
comply with the IEC 60601-1 safety requirements for medical electrical systems.
Any person who connects external equipment to USB has formed a system and is
therefore responsible for the system to comply with the requirements of IEC 60601-1.
If in doubt, contact a qualified technician or the manufacturer’s representative.
